Configuring the CMP System to Manage SPR Subscriber Data

The CMP system can manage SPR subscriber data. Before this can occur, the CMP operating mode must support managing SPR clusters.
CAUTION: CMP operating modes should only be set in consultation with My Oracle Support. Setting modes inappropriately can result in the loss of network element connectivity, policy function, OM statistical data, and cluster redundancy.

To reconfigure the CMP operating mode:

  1. From the Help section of the navigation pane, select About.

    The About page opens, displaying the CMP software release number.

  2. Click the Change Mode button.

    Consult with My Oracle Support for information on this button.

    The Mode Settings page opens.

  3. In the Mode section, select the mode Diameter 3GPP, Diameter 3GPP2, or PCC Extensions, as appropriate.
  4. At the bottom of the page, select Manage SPR Subscriber Data.
  5. Click OK.

    The browser page closes and you are automatically logged out.

  6. Refresh the browser page.

    The Welcome page opens.

You are now ready to define an SPR cluster profile and manage SPR subscriber profile and pooled quota data.
